TICKET-2087: Webhook handler refusing connections

Plugin authors report the Parcelpost tracking webhook returning connection resets during carrier bursts. Root cause: the status DB pool saturates at 20 connections and the handler hard-fails instead of queuing. Workaround until the fix ships: throttle your test pushes to 5/sec. To reproduce against staging, use the connection string below.

replica DSN, yahaf-yagaf: mongodb://tamath_svc:a2netSk3RZMuTj@db-d084.novacsoft.internal:5432/ralmir

Subject: Warranty costs running hot on the Brindlemark line

Team — quick flag before the exec call. Warranty claims on the Brindlemark compressors are tracking 38% over plan, mostly seal failures from the Ostheim batch. Finance says the reserve covers us through Q2, but not beyond if the claim rate holds. We're pausing extended-warranty upsells in affected regions until engineering confirms the fix. Sales leads, please steer customers toward the Corveld model in the meantime. There's one sensitive detail I need to add below.

board note of fahap-yafop: Headcount on the Istion team goes from 50 to 73 by the end of September. Gross margin on Istion came in at 33 percent against a plan of 28 percent.

HANDOVER — Facilities Desk

Marta is taking over the Brightfield Expo pop-up office for Quillon Systems from me tonight. The cabin keys are in drawer three; the printer needs toner by Thursday. Vendor deliveries arrive rear gate only, before 09:00. To open the pop-up's main shutter each morning, enter this door-pass code on the keypad.

turnstile pass: bdg-NG-3

# Event Schema Registry Provenance

The Corvalin registry pins every event schema to the commit that produced it. Producers on the Mistfall bus must declare a schema version at publish time; unregistered versions are rejected at the broker. Consumers can resolve any version back to its source tree and signing attestation. Each registry snapshot is stamped with the build token shown below.

trace token, fafog-kageg: htk4_98e6